New Version of Clevite Heavy Duty CEEK Program Available Online

In order to better meet the heavy duty needs of its fleet, agricultural, construction, industrial and marine customers, Clevite Engine Parts updated its Heavy Duty CEEK (Clevite Electronic Engine Kits) program, which can now be found at Heavydutyenginekits.com.

Bill Glasgow Sr. Wins OAC Lifetime Achievement Award

Bill Glasgow Sr., president of W.T. Glasgow Inc. in Orland Park, IL, received the Lifetime Achievement Award from the Overseas Automotive Council (OAC) yesterday during AAPEX. For the past 20 years, Glasgow has directed his family-owned and operated trade show management firm, W. T. Glasgow, Inc.

Nu-Way Teams With Pricedex to Launch Aftermarket Data Portal

Nu-Way Automotive Systems, Inc. and Pricedex Software, Inc. have joined for the development of a Web-based portal designed to give aftermarket businesses – particularly smaller companies – quick and easy access to high-quality market data at a price even the smallest service provider can afford. In addition, the companies announced that Pricedex would act as a strategic provider of Nu-Way research data.

Morse Automotive and Vertical Development Team Up to Implement Industry Standard

Morse Automotive has teamed up with content management systems provider Vertical Development, Inc. (VDI), and its e-Publisher catalog management system to help the disc brake pads supplier generate multiple friction catalogs in a variety of formats from a single relational database. Through this partnership, Morse will be able to export files that meet the latest ACES (AAIA Catalog Enhanced Standard) requirements.

Car Care Month Vehicle Check-Up Event Demo to be Held at AAPEX

A new seminar demonstrating how to increase service and parts sales by hosting local vehicle check up events for consumers will take place on Thursday, Nov. 3 at the Sands Expo Center during AAPEX in Las Vegas. Attendees will receive a complimentary DVD that provides step-by-step instructions on planning, marketing and executing these popular events during Car Care Months in April and October. The seminar, designed for repair shop owners, technicians, WDs, jobbers and program groups, will be held from 8 to 9 a.m. in room 302 of the Sands Expo Center.

National Truck Equipment Association Releases Annual Manufacturers Shipments Survey

As a provider of market data and research to its members, the National Truck Equipment Association (NTEA) recently released the sixth Annual Manufacturers Shipments Survey (AMSS) to companies that participated in the study. The goal of the AMSS is to provide the commercial truck and transportation equipment industry with a credible source of data for market size in dollars and units, as well as annual growth.
